Career & Technical

Earn Credentials for Employment

Programs in this track are designed to help students acquire practical accounting skills so they can enter the workforce. In as little as one quarter, students can attain certification in basic entry-level accounting clerk skills.

The graduate of the full two-year program will be well-prepared for employment and advancement in accounting and business fields.

In general, courses in the Career and Technical Education track are not transferable to universities. However, Green River graduates may be able to transfer their two-year AAA-Accounting degree to Bellevue College’s Bachelor of Applied Science in Applied Accounting degree program.

University Transfer

Be Prepared for Your Four-Year Program

For students who plan to transfer to a four-year university as accounting or business majors, Green River offers the Associate in Business Degree – Direct Transfer AgreementStudents in this track take a three-quarter sequence of transfer-level accounting courses. This degree is designed to meet the distribution requirements at universities in Washington state by fulfilling the general requirements taken by freshmen and sophomores.

EMPLOYMENT OUTLOOK

Occupations: Bookkeeper, Billing Clerk, Accounting Clerk, Tax Preparer, Payroll Administrator

Earnings: Range from $16.36 to $20.00 an hour, entry to mid-level.

Data source: CareerOneStop.org
